Sudden cardiac death in infants, children, and adolescents

Sudden cardiac death (SCD) in young people often has underlying cardiac conditions. Early screening with detailed history and physical exams can identify at-risk individuals for further cardiac evaluation.

Background:

  • Sudden cardiac death (SCD) in infants, children, and adolescents, while uncommon, carries a profound psychosocial impact.
  • Many SCD cases involve identifiable cardiac diseases, but some arise from undiagnosed conditions like hypertrophic cardiomyopathy or long QT syndrome.

Purpose of the Study:

  • To review potential causes of SCD in pediatric populations.
  • To emphasize the role of early screening in identifying at-risk individuals for sudden cardiac death.

Main Methods:

  • Comprehensive review of existing literature on SCD causes in pediatric patients.
  • Analysis of diagnostic approaches including detailed patient and family history, review of systems, and physical examinations.
  • Recommendation for further cardiac evaluation (ECG, echocardiogram) based on initial screening findings.

Main Results:

  • Identifiable cardiac diseases are often present in pediatric SCD cases.
  • Undiagnosed conditions such as hypertrophic cardiomyopathy and long QT syndrome can present as the first manifestation of SCD.
  • Thorough clinical assessment can detect many at-risk pediatric patients.

Conclusions:

  • A detailed history and physical examination are crucial for screening pediatric patients for conditions associated with SCD.
  • Patients with positive findings on screening should undergo further cardiac investigations like ECG and echocardiography.
  • These diagnostic tools can detect most cardiac abnormalities linked to SCD in the pediatric population.

Mechanism of Cardiac Arrhythmias

Arrhythmias are irregular heart rhythms occurring when the heart's electrical impulses become abnormal. These disturbances can lead to various symptoms, depending on their severity and the underlying cause. Some common factors contributing to arrhythmias include hypoxia, ischemia, electrolyte imbalances, excessive catecholamine exposure, drug toxicity, and muscle overstretching. Arrhythmias can be classified into two main types based on the rate and site of origin of abnormal heart rhythms.

Disturbances in Heart Rhythm

Arrhythmia or dysrhythmia refers to an abnormal heart rhythm caused by a defect in the heart's conduction system. It can cause the heart to beat irregularly, too quickly, or too slowly, leading to symptoms like chest pain, shortness of breath, and fainting. Factors such as stress, caffeine, alcohol, nicotine, cocaine, certain drugs, congenital defects, diseases, and electrolyte abnormalities can trigger arrhythmias.
